Mileah Girl

Popularity: #934 · Trend: ↘ Falling

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: mi-LEE-uh //mɪˈliːə//

Origin: Hebrew; English

Meaning: Mileah (Hebrew) - 'a form of the name Malia'; Mileah (English) - 'a variant of Leah'

U.S. Historical Usage

The name Mileah was first seen in the United States in 1990.

Mileah has ranked as high as #1318 nationally, which occurred in 2011, and has been most popular in California.

In the past 5 years the name Mileah has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
